Carrollton Middle-Upper Elementary School is a 4th Grade-6th Grade Public School located in Carrollton, GA within the Carrollton City District. It has 1123 students in grades 4th Grade-6th Grade with a student-teacher ratio of 19 to 1. Carrollton Middle-Upper Elementary School spends $10,559 per student.
